CAFE — Compound-AI Factorial Evaluation

Stop guessing which AI config is better. Prove it.

CAFE treats every knob in your AI pipeline - retrieval, reranking, prompts, models, and tools - as an experimental factor. It runs factorial experiments, evaluates outputs using a configurable LLM (and optionally human reviewers), and applies mixed-effects models to determine: - Which techniques actually improve quality - How much each technique contributes - Whether the observed differences are statistically significant Open source and self-hostable.

Hi! As part of a research paper, we built CAFE to answer a question that kept coming up: when I tweaked my RAG or agent pipeline and the output improved, which change actually made the difference? Aggregate benchmarks and eyeballing a handful of outputs never really answered that - especially when LLMs are nondeterministic from run to run. CAFE treats every knob in your pipeline (retrieval, reranking, context assembly, prompts, models, tools, etc.) as an experimental factor. It: - Generates a full or fractional factorial design - every configuration combination worth testing - Runs each configuration as a black box with replication (concurrent and resumable) - Scores outputs using a configurable LLM judge and/or human raters - Attributes performance differences using mixed-effects models matched to your rubric's scale The result is a statistically grounded answer to questions like: - Which techniques actually improve quality? - How much does each technique contribute? - What is the best-performing configuration? - Are the observed differences real, or just noise? CAFE also includes a cost–quality Pareto frontier and judge↔human agreement analysis using Krippendorff's α. It's open source (Apache-2.0) and fully self-hostable. You can use it as a Python librar or a FastAPI + React web application.
